Crockpot Cheeseburgers

Delicious and creamy cheeseburgers made easily in a slow cooker, perfect for gatherings.

  • Total Time: 255 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 teaspoon olive oil
  • 1 ½ pounds lean ground beef
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 8 ounces Velveeta cheese, cubed
  • 2 tablespoons ketchup
  • 2 tablespoons mustard
  • Buns, for serving
  • Cheese slices, for serving
  • Pickles, for serving

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
  2. Add lean ground beef and diced onion. Cook until beef is browned and no longer pink, and onions are translucent.
  3. Add minced garlic and cook for an additional 30 seconds until fragrant.
  4. Transfer the cooked beef mixture to a slow cooker.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Stir in cubed Velveeta cheese, ketchup, and mustard until well combined.
  5. Cover and cook on low heat for 3 to 4 hours. Stir occasionally to ensure even cooking and flavor distribution.
  6. Scoop the cheesy beef mixture onto buns. Top with additional cheese slices and pickles for a classic cheeseburger experience.

Notes

For a spicier kick, add diced jalapeños or hot sauce. You can also use different types of cheese or substitute the ground beef with turkey or chicken.
